Hi! I’m Erika, a patient tutor who specializes in mathematics, from arithmetic up to calculus, including precalculus, trigonometry, and core algebra. My goal is not just to help you solve problems, but to help you truly understand why the math works and how it connects to the bigger picture.

My Teaching Method and Techniques:
I focus on two main pillars:

-Understanding the logic behind math
Instead of just memorizing formulas, I explain the ideas behind them.

-Repetition with purpose
I use carefully chosen exercises that help you practice key ideas until they become automatic.

I also spend time identifying what’s lacking in your understanding. Once I see exactly where the gaps are, I focus on those areas while still keeping the broader context in mind, so you don’t lose the connection between different topics.

A Typical Lesson Plan:
Here’s how a typical lesson might look:

-Quick check-in (5–10 minutes)
We briefly discuss what you’ve already studied, what you find difficult, and what you’d like to focus on today.

-Concept explanation (15–20 minutes)
I explain the core idea, often starting from simpler examples and building up to more complex ones. I use clear language, diagrams, and step-by-step reasoning.

-Guided practice (20–30 minutes)
You work through problems with my support. I ask questions, offer hints, and help you correct mistakes by reasoning together, rather than just giving the answer.

-Independent practice (15–20 minutes)
You try similar problems on your own, so you can build confidence and see for yourself what you’ve mastered.

-Wrap-up and reflection (5–10 minutes)
We review what we covered, summarize what you now understand better, and plan what to focus on next time.

Depending on the topic and your level, I adjust the length and focus of each part.
